About Karen Human Rights Group
khrg is an independent community-based organisation working to improve the human rights situation in burma by projecting the voices of villagers and supporting their strategies to cl... Read more
khrg is an independent community-based organisation working to improve the human rights situation in burma by projecting the voices of villagers and supporting their strategies to cl... Read more